About Us:


 

Barry-Wehmiller is a diversified global supplier of engineering consulting and manufacturing technology for the packaging, corrugating, sheeting and paper-converting industries. By blending people-centric leadership with disciplined operational strategies and purpose-driven growth, Barry-Wehmiller has become a $3 billion organization with nearly 12,000 team members united by a common belief: to use the power of business to build a better world.

Position Description:

At Barry-Wehmiller, we measure success by the way we touch the lives of people.  We have an immediate opportunity for a tax leader with a domestic focus, reporting to the Assistant Tax Director. This position is primarily responsible for assisting with all aspects of the domestic corporate tax function including ensuring compliance with tax reporting requirements as well as the accuracy of the tax related financial statement disclosures.

Principal Duties and Responsibilities (Essential Functions):  

  • Prepare and review income tax returns on federal, state, and international levels.
  • Assist in ensuring that the company complies with relevant tax laws and that tax returns and payments are processed on time
  • Complete and review income tax provisions for each legal entity, ensuring timeliness and accuracy for statutory audit and ASC740 purposes.
  • Lead a team of multiple associates through cyclical tax processes as well as non-recurring tax planning opportunities or projects.
  • The Tax Manager is responsible for all tax types, including indirect tax (sales, property, payroll, etc.) and coordinating with other BW departments to ensure compliance with Federal, State and Local tax regulations.
  • Proven ability to problem-solve complicated projects, implementing process improvements and providing innovative solutions.
  • Act as liaison with external auditors, external tax agents and tax offices (if required).
  • Performs tax research as necessary.
